"Reason" by Jung Il-young, from the 2000 K-drama Autumn in My Heart (also known as Endless Love ), is a renowned ballad with lyrics by Kim Won-hee. The song's themes revolve around forbidden love, the struggle to let go, and the heartbreak of separation, mirroring the drama's storyline. The lyrics are a desperate plea, with themes of dependence, featuring the iconic English-translated line "You must not disappear from my life". As a crucial part of the show's soundtrack, which helped spark the global "Korean Wave," the song is frequently cited in discussions of the drama's immense cultural impact.
